MALHOUN MALHOUN | | Product Name: | MALHOUN | | Product Type | Sofa Collection | | A modular collection of seating which is both rigorous and convivial, Malhoun's success lies in the contrast between the pure geometry of its seat and feet, and the warm welcome afforded by its tufted back and randomly distributed back cushions. Its low, horizontal proportions, both in terms of the seat and the back, visually broaden its dimensions and give a striking impression of lightness. |
| Designer | Didier Gomez | | Didier Gomez began his career as an opera singer before branching out into the world of interior and product design in 1985 with his association with the architect JJ Ory. His expertise is highly acclaimed. Winner of numerous design awards, he has designed boutiques, large stores, restaurants, apartments, houses and head offices all over the world.
The quality of his work speaks for itself, with clients including Yves Saint-Laurent, Pierre Bergé, Carrousel du Louvre, LVMH, Bernard Arnault, Céline, Louis Vuitton, Galeries Lafayette, Vivendi Universal, Kenzo, Christian Dior, Pomelato, De Beers and L’Oréal.
Didier Gomez began working with Ligne Roset some fifteen years ago. Both he and Michel Roset have since forged an enduring partnership based on a creative synergy. The number of creations for Ligne Roset seems countless, but numbering among the most successful are his upholstery collections. Feng, Opium and Fugue have become symbols of his sleek, contemporary take on classic urban style. Rue de Seine looks set to follow. Didier Gomez and Ligne Roset were awarded the ‘Nombre d’or’ by the Salon du Meuble de Paris, in recognition of their exemplary collaboration. | | Company | Ligne Roset |
